A RARE CASE OF BICORNOATE UTERUS WITH TWIN PREGNANCY: ONE PREGNANCY IN EACH HORN!!

Journal Title: Journal of Evidence Based Medicine and Healthcare - Year 2014, Vol 1, Issue 10

Abstract

BICORNUATE UTERUS1,2 is a congenital uterine anomaly caused by incomplete lateral fusion of the mullerian ducts.  It is CLASS-IV mullerian anomaly according to the AMERICAN SOCIETY OF REPRODUCTIVE MEDICINE classification. Incidence of uterine malformations - 4% in fertile women, 3.5-6% in infertile women, 13% in patients with recurrent abortions. 3,4,5 Bicornuate uterus – 25% of all uterine malformations.5  Bicornuate uterus is associated with adverse pregnancy outcomes6, 7, 8, 9 like 1. Recurrent pregnancy loss 2. Preterm birth 3. Malpresentations. Live birth rate with a bicornuate uterus is 40-60%.9
